Understanding Threatened Abortion:

Threatened abortion refers to vaginal bleeding during the early stages of pregnancy that raises concerns about the potential loss of the pregnancy. While clinical evaluation is essential, radiological imaging provides valuable insights into the condition. It helps determine the viability of the pregnancy, identify potential causes of the bleeding, and guide appropriate management decisions.

Imaging Modalities for Threatened Abortion:

  1. Transvaginal Ultrasound: Transvaginal ultrasound is the primary imaging modality used for evaluating threatened abortion. It provides high-resolution images of the pelvic organs, allowing visualization of the uterus, gestational sac, and fetal structures. Ultrasound can help confirm the presence of a viable pregnancy, assess fetal heartbeat, measure gestational age, and identify any abnormalities that may contribute to the bleeding.

  2. Doppler Ultrasound: Doppler ultrasound is a specialized form of ultrasound that evaluates blood flow. It can be used to assess the blood flow within the uterus and placenta, providing information about the vascular status of the pregnancy. Doppler ultrasound helps determine if there are any abnormalities in the blood supply that may contribute to the threatened abortion.

  3. Magnetic Resonance Imaging (MRI): Although less commonly used, MRI may be employed in specific cases of threatened abortion. MRI provides detailed images of the pelvic structures and can help evaluate the uterus, placenta, and surrounding tissues. It may be particularly useful when ultrasound findings are inconclusive or when additional information is required for diagnosis or management planning.

Benefits of Radiological Assessment:

Radiological imaging offers several benefits in the evaluation of threatened abortion. It provides a non-invasive and safe method for assessing the condition, allowing for prompt diagnosis and appropriate management decisions. Imaging helps differentiate between viable and non-viable pregnancies, aiding in the determination of potential outcomes. It also helps identify any underlying structural or vascular abnormalities that may require specific interventions or treatments.
